Linked Workshop: Clearing Immunisation Backlogs and Building Back Better in the Wake of Covid-19

LOOK AT THIS IF YOU'RE INTERESTED IN:

Exploring good practices and approaches to address immunisation backlog in the wake of Covid-19.

HOW YOU CAN USE THESE MATERIALS:

Countries who have observed immunisation backlog can adapt the good practices and country experiences shared during this workshop to ensure that children are not missed out with vaccines and immunisation services.

OVERVIEW:

Stakeholders from Bhutan, India, Indonesia, Pakistan, Philippines, Sri Lanka, and Vietnam came together to discuss promising practices to clear the immunisation backlog that has built up over the last two years while continuing to provide routine immunisation. The Linked workshop revealed a wealth of information on the challenges countries have faced due to the pandemic, what they are doing to address the resulting backlog, and the approaches, good practices, and lessons learned that emerged and how to continue them to ensure that children are not missed out.
